Taipei City Government Reviewed New Illegal Construction in Accordance with the Report of the Audit Department: 309 Cases Will be RectifiedThe Taipei City Audit Department of the National Audit Office pointed out in its major review opinions of the “2015 Review Report of Taipei City Government’s Local General Financial Statement”, that the comparisons of the numeric maps of six administrative districts of Taipei City and other data, found 186 use permits with suspicious rooftop illegal construction, which should be reviewed and improved. According to the inspection results of Taipei City Construction Management Office, there are 175 use permits involving new illegal rooftop construction. On June 30, 2017, 309 cases of illegal construction inspection and reporting (including illegal construction of balconies, terraces, roof decks, etc.) were completed.According to the Office, for those 309 cases of new illegal construction that have been inspected, official letters will be sent to the owners of the illegal construction to request improvements by the specified time period after the process service has been completed; the cases will be handled in accordance with the relevant regulations of illegal construction. The owners of illegal construction shall not leave things to chance. Owners are expected to dismantle the illegal construction immediately, or the Office will do so at the respective owners’ expense.
